Baba Siddique murder: 4500-page charge sheet rules out SRA angle, says Salman Khan was main target

Crime Branch’s 4,500-page charge sheet rules out SRA angle; says NCP leader’s proximity to Salman was main reason he was targetted

The Anti-Extortion Cell of the Mumbai Crime Branch on Monday submitted a 4,590-page detailed charge sheet against 26 arrested individuals and three wanted suspects in the murder case of NCP leader Baba Siddique. The charge sheet dismisses the SRA (Slum Rehabilitation Authority) angle as a possible motive for the murder, a claim previously made by Siddique’s son, former Bandra East MLA Zeeshan.
